No, it's not possible in a strict sense. Java is more type safe than C - in C there is no real array type...
What you can have is an array of references (=pointers) to arrays of doubles, or double[][], and what your code does is more commonly written asdouble[][] dbl2 = new dobule[m][10];

  • How to copy an array element in one class to an array in another class?

    Hi,
    I have a ClassRoom class that stores a list of Student objects in an array. How would I copy a Student object from the Student[] array in the ClassRoom class to an array in another class?
    Is it something like this:
    System.arraycopy(Students, 2, AnotherClass.Array, 0, 2);In an array do the items get copied over existing array elements or can the be added to the end? If so, how would I specify add copied object reference to the end of the array in the other class?

    drew22299 wrote:
    Hi,
    I have a ClassRoom class that stores a list of Student objects in an array. How would I copy a Student object from the Student[] array in the ClassRoom class to an array in another class?
    Is it something like this:
    System.arraycopy(Students, 2, AnotherClass.Array, 0, 2);In an array do the items get copied over existing array elements or can the be added to the end? If so, how would I specify add copied object reference to the end of the array in the other class?System.arrayCopy will overwrite whatever is already in the array. It is your job to make sure it copies into the proper array location.
    That being said, you're only moving a single student. This is not something you would use arrayCopy for, as you can just do that with simple assignment. Also, you should consider giving Class a method to add a student to its student list, as the class should know how many students it has and can easily "append" to the array.
    Note: I hope you noticed the quotes around append. Java's arrays are fixed size. Once allocated, their size cannot change. You may want to consider using one of the List implementations (ArrayList, for example) instead.
